I don’t think this is about whether or not he knows you’re interested — you matched on a dating app so obviously there’s got to be some level of interest. What matters are both of your intentions, and if they’re any good or not. You left him in the first place alone because you felt like he was closed off, and I’m not sure why you’d think that this would change in one month. He said himself he’s still guarded, slow and cautious, which to me does not sound like a man who’s changed, or one who is genuinely looking to date a woman. Instead he most likely just wants what he can get from her, whether that’s attention, casual sex or even just having some company. You on the other hand sound like you genuinely would like to connect with a guy and pursue something. So if that is what you want, then it makes the most sense to find a guy who you know wants the same thing. Right now, you don’t know what this dude wants from you, so you should definitely ask. There’s no use falling for someone who is emotionally unavailable.
Per your update, I would definitely be done with him. Simply put — he doesn’t want a relationship but he wants the benefits that come with one. He’s trying to relay this to you in a way that doesn’t completely run you off and instead you’re being breadcrumbed. Breadcrumbing is basically when someone gives you just enough hope and optimism to make you stick around but never actually officiate things with you. Which to me isn’t a good guy to deal with. You may only have a crush on him right now, which is the best time to leave, instead of letting those feelings grow into love and then it’s much harder to walk away. I’m sure you’re tried of dating and trying to find a man but there are much better candidates out there with far less baggage.
